As seen, a range hood is important for induction cooking because it cuts down energy costs, helps cool off the air, eliminates odors from your cooking, and enables you to achieve a … Web6 okt. 2024 · Larger ducts will be able to exhaust more smoke, so use at least 6 inches. On the larger CFM blowers, you will need 8 or 10 inches. Use a rigid duct only. Grease can be caught in the joints of a flexible duct. It's against code in many states. Make-Up Air. For new construction, any vent over 400 CFM needs the equivalent fresh air return. Web29 nov. 2024 · Induction does NOT work with aluminum or copper. Cast iron is great and so is most steel. A magnet must be able to stick to the bottom. If it doesn’t it won’t heat up as the energy in the pan is obtained from a magnetic field. WebGiven below are the most common reasons why a deep fryer creates smoke. 1. Use of incorrect oil. Ensure that the oil you use has a high smoke point. The smoke point is the temperature at which the oil starts to break down, and smoke starts to form. Generally, the more refined the oil is, the higher the smoke point.
